What is a sun simulator?
A sun simulator is a special light system that copies the intensity, spectrum and uniformity of sunlight. With its help, solar panels are tested on Standard Test Conditions (STC), such as:
- Irradiance: 1000 W/m²
- Temperature: 25°C
- Air Mass: AM 1.5
In these conditions the actual capacity of the solar panel is measured.

types of sun simulator
1. Xenon Sun Simulator
- most used
- Gives spectrum similar to sunlight
- high accuracy
2. LED Sun Simulator
- low power consumption
- long life
- low maintenance
3. Metal Halide Sun Simulator
- affordable
- good performance

How does the sun simulator work?
Sun simulator shines artificial sunlight on solar panels. After this the machine measures the current, voltage and power of the solar panel. This shows whether the solar panel is working properly or not.
